    Silverstream bt Wellington in a fairly dominant performance in the Wellington College final yesterday. They won 31-12 and there are certainly a few players with big futures in the game.

    Silverstream have two tall and beefy locks in Samuel Thomson and Preston Moananu who would already be bigger than any recent Hurricanes lock apart from Isaia Walker-Leawere. Hopefully Wellington and the Hurricanes have their sights on them.

    Thompson Takapua, the Silverstream number 10 and number 7 Drew Berg-McLean were arguably Silverstream's best two players on the park (followed closely by the mountain Samuel Thompson). Takapua looks to have all the skills to be a professional 10 with all the silky skills in the world. I don't think I've seen a 10 this good out of Wellington since Lima Sopoaga. Hopefully he can kick on.

    Big Wellington College lock Harry Law who I understand is heading down to Canterbury was the standout in a losing effort by Wellington College.

    I know De La Salle and St Paul’s very well. Many of those 1st 15 rugby players in those teams are league boys who play rugby at college. They’ve grown up playing club rugby league and then play union at College on Saturdays and league is played on Wednesdays. The list doesn’t tell the whole story. It goes both ways, obviously league is poaching more but it also goes the other way.
